Price: $10 Legal malpractice arises when your lawyer's performance falls below the standard of care in the industry. That is the first burden of proof; showing that the attorney was negligent. But that is not the end of the story. It is possible that your attorney was negligent, but it didn't cause you any harm. To use a simple fact pattern to illustrate the point, assume that a defendant owes money under a promissory note, and has absolutely no defense. If the attorney fails to show up on the day of trial, that is clearly negligent, but would the outcome have been any different if there was no defense to the money owing? If not, then the defendant did not really suffer any damages. In other words, the attorney's negligence was not the cause of the damage award. The defendant would have a breach of contract action against the attorney since he or she failed to perform the duties promised, but there would be no legal malpractice action. Russellville

Minnesota uses modified joint and several liability in that generally a person whose fault is fifteen percent or less is liable for a percentage no greater than four times his percentage of fault. If one of the defendants is uncollectible, the court will reallocate that defendant's share to the others. Contribution in Minnesota is in proportion to percentage of fault. Misdiagnosis can cause existing oral health problems to worsen and can lead to irreparable personal injuries. Many dental negligence compensation claimants suffer from severe periodontal (gum) disease, despite having regular check-ups that should have noticed the condition in its early stages. Misdiagnosis can also see patients going through unnecessary dental procedures, which can be costly and can cause damage to their teeth and oral health. In Wisconsin, medical malpractice occurs when a health care provider injures a patient by administering substandard medical treatment. A health care provider has a duty to act within a certain standard of care when providing medical treatment to all patients. If the health care provider acts below this standard of care, resulting in injury to the patient, then the health care provider has been medically negligent. Medical negligence is actionable, meaning the patient may bring a medical malpractice action against the health care provider. I wanted to help clean up, Ashanti said. Norals' natural reflex was to... In Louisiana, there are special procedures which must be followed in medical malpractice cases. For example, in Louisiana, a claim must be filed with the State before a lawsuit can be filed. This claim is then reviewed by a panel of three Louisiana doctors, who give an opinion about whether any health care provider committed malpractice. Only after the panel has reached its decision can a lawsuit be filed. There are many complicated details to this Louisiana panel procedure, and many traps for the inexperienced Louisiana attorney. In addressing the plaintiff's equal protection argument, the Appellate Court stated that MICRA's noneconomic damages cap does not wholly deny compensation to medical malpractice plaintiffs (i.e., there is no limitation on the recovery of actual damages, such as medical costs and lost wages, and there is only a partial limitation on the recovery of noneconomic damages). The Appellate Court further stated that while there is significant debate about the wisdom and efficacy of damages caps in controlling medical malpractice insurance costs, it is a matter of legitimate debate. Errors in the medical or dental setting can occur at any point during a procedure. Anesthesia mistakes can result in a person being aware of what is happening rather than being safely sedated. Use of the wrong element during anesthesia can result in brain damage, serious injury, a loss of function, or death of the patient. Cutting errors may occur during laparoscopic procedures, causing bleeding. There have been cases where a surgeon has removed the wrong breast or other body part by mistake. A slip of the knife can pierce or cut a vital organ, leading to death. Birth injuries can cause brain damage or permanent disability for an infant. Negligence during postoperative patient care can also cause harm, with infections and other problems that could lead to death or disability.
